The Mechanics Behind the Flight: Understanding How It Works
At its core, the Aviator game revolves around a plane that takes off and ascends as multipliers increase, and the player’s goal is to cash out before the plane flies away. It sounds simple, but the unpredictability of when the plane will take off adds a layer of excitement. This mechanic encourages a delicate balance between timing and nerve.
The game’s design, often powered by providers like Spribe, focuses on fairness and transparency, employing certified random number generators that ensure no two rounds are alike. This ensures that while patterns can emerge, the outcome remains unpredictable — a fact that keeps players coming back for more. The RTP (Return to Player) rate usually hovers around the mid-90s percentile, which is respectable in comparison to other casino-style games.
Practical Tips for Navigating the Unexpected Twists
Getting comfortable with the Aviator game requires patience and strategy. From my experience, rushing to cash out too early often means missing out on bigger rewards, while waiting too long can result in losing everything. It’s a classic risk-reward scenario that’s as much psychological as it is mathematical.
Here are a few pointers I’d suggest for beginners:
- Start with small bets to understand the game’s pace and variance.
- Watch a few rounds before you dive in to get a sense of timing.
- Set clear limits for losses and winnings to avoid impulsive decisions.
- Remember, no strategy guarantees success; the game thrives on chance.
Recognizing these elements can help maintain enjoyment without falling prey to frustration or loss-driven chasing.
